Best cruise for a single female cruiser?
in Solo Cruisers
Posted · Edited by Losangelesgurl
if you can, try to make dinner "anytime"5:45 pm!!!
.. later dining ( 7pm-9pm is all large tables/ families!! and
crying babies,and grandparents..very awkward!
I found the lonliness part actually oddly enough was
not having balcony to just "be alone without being alone"
on the deck over and over and over.....
I also found double bed in the window view.. cabin very
depressing..oddly...nobody next to me..no roomie.
ANY cruise around 7 days,i think 13 is way too long
without a companion.!!!.and I am very very comfortable alone
I felt I wanted someone who is heart felt to "chat with" not
a stranger..it gets really superficial after a while..
I would say having a roommate assigned for longer trip
would benefit you..putting up with some minor things
is better then landing in cabin and nobody
to say "wow" hows it going? some lines can
arrange a cabin mate
1. bring notepad and pen ( to give out name /room #or meeting place)
2. bring extra wine ( or cup) and share a drink while on deck
time....makes 4 instant connection.
3. don't isolate yourself...do join in group silly stuff
as you meet more solo/singles,in the dancing,and karaoke too.
